Skip to content

Commit ff8a861

Browse files
committedFeb 12, 2020
1.1.4
1 parent 39df63d commit ff8a861

5 files changed

+23
-11
lines changed
 

‎composer.json

+1-1
Original file line numberDiff line numberDiff line change
@@ -1,6 +1,6 @@
11
{
22
"name": "styletools/lazy",
3-
"version": "1.1.3",
3+
"version": "1.1.4",
44
"description": "A lightweight lazy loader based on `window.IntersectionObserver` with tiny fallback for old browsers.",
55
"keywords": ["lazy",
66
"images",

‎dist/lazy+data-attr+polyfill+events.js

+4-4
Some generated files are not rendered by default. Learn more about customizing how changed files appear on GitHub.

‎dist/lazy+webp+data-attr+polyfill+events.js

+5-5
Some generated files are not rendered by default. Learn more about customizing how changed files appear on GitHub.

‎package.json

+1-1
Original file line numberDiff line numberDiff line change
@@ -1,6 +1,6 @@
11
{
22
"name": "@style.tools/lazy",
3-
"version": "1.1.3",
3+
"version": "1.1.4",
44
"description": "A lightweight lazy image and iframe loader based on `window.IntersectionObserver` with tiny fallback for old browsers.",
55
"author": {
66
"name": "info@style.tools",

‎src/lazy.js

+12
Original file line numberDiff line numberDiff line change
@@ -22,6 +22,10 @@ function GET_DATA_ATTR(el, attr) {
2222
return el.getAttribute('data-' + attr);
2323
}
2424

25+
function REMOVE_DATA_ATTR(el, attr) {
26+
return el.removeAttribute('data-' + attr);
27+
}
28+
2529
// query
2630
function QUERY(selector) {
2731
return doc.querySelectorAll(selector);
@@ -76,6 +80,10 @@ function $lazy(config, inview, observer_callback) {
7680
}
7781
}
7882
target[SRCSET] = srcset;
83+
84+
if (CLICK_EXTENSION) {
85+
REMOVE_DATA_ATTR(target, SRCSET);
86+
}
7987
}
8088

8189
if ( src ) {
@@ -86,6 +94,10 @@ function $lazy(config, inview, observer_callback) {
8694
}
8795
}
8896
target[SRC] = src;
97+
98+
if (CLICK_EXTENSION) {
99+
REMOVE_DATA_ATTR(target, SRC);
100+
}
89101
}
90102

91103
// hook for sending a custom event etc.

0 commit comments

Comments
 (0)
Please sign in to comment.